CULTURAL COOPERATION OF THE CIS COUNTRIES IN MODERN CONDITIONS: CHALLENGES, STRATEGY, OBJECTIVES

Annotation: The geopolitical transformations of our time have set new objectives in the organization and implementation of cultural cooperation. The foreign cultural patterns that have spread in countries, often alien to the national mentality, have led to the leveling of the cultural and civic identity of citizens, especially young people. At the present stage, which is characterized by the formation of a new multipolar world, the consequences of Westernization are being eliminated in the CIS countries, the strengthening of national identity and the development of cultural cooperation and the preservation of centuries–old civilizational and spiritual ties of the peoples of the CIS member states. The purpose of this study is to identify the role and strategic mission of cultural cooperation of the CIS countries in countering socio-cultural threats and ensuring the stability of the new multipolar world. The analysis of the foreign policy concepts of the CIS countries and the experience of their cultural cooperation has shown that culture is a basic element in the national security system of any country, as well as an effective way to strengthen international relations. The authors analyzed the experience and results of the work of the Commonwealth of Asian Educational Institutions in the field of culture, which unites institutes and universities of culture and arts of Kazakhstan, Kyrgyzstan, Tajikistan, Uzbekistan and Siberia. The priority tasks of the Commonwealth's activities are: training qualified personnel who understand the specifics and value of the national cultures of the CIS countries and are able to carry out professional activities in the context of digital transformation of the cultural environment. The development of cooperation between the members of the Commonwealth in the field of education, enlightenment, science, and creativity has gone from participation in each other's events to the implementation of common projects. At the present stage, three joint projects of the Commonwealth aimed at preserving the patterns of native culture and mastering the cultural heritage of other peoples, forming the experience of international cooperation among future cultural leaders, were included in the joint action plan for the implementation of the results of the Russia–Central Asia summit of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of the Russian Federation.
